Various small changes.
[tinc] / debian / tinc-up
index 0ca5ebe..0e40d76 100644 (file)
@@ -1,7 +1,7 @@
 #! /usr/bin/perl -w
 #
 # Device configuration script for tinc
-# $Id: tinc-up,v 1.1.2.1 2000/11/24 16:52:57 zarq Exp $
+# $Id: tinc-up,v 1.1.2.2 2000/12/22 16:54:56 zarq Exp $
 #
 # Based on Lubomir Bulej's Redhat init script.
 #
@@ -42,8 +42,7 @@ sub vpn_load {
        }
     }
     if(!defined($DEV)) {
-       warn "tinc: There must be a TapDevice\n";
-       return 0;
+       $DEV = "/dev/tap0";
     }
     if($DEV eq "") {
        warn "tinc: TapDevice should be of the form /dev/tapN\n";
@@ -75,7 +74,7 @@ sub vpn_load {
     $ADR = pack('C4', @addr);
     $MSK = pack('N4', -1 << (32 - $LEN));
     $BRD = join(".", unpack('C4', $ADR | ~$MSK));
-    $MAC = "fe:fd:" . join(":", map { sprintf "%02x", $_ } unpack('C4', $ADR));
+    $MAC = "fe:fd:00:00:00:00";
 
     if(!defined($VPNMASK)) {
        $VPNMASK = $MSK;
@@ -83,7 +82,7 @@ sub vpn_load {
     }
     $ADR = join(".", unpack('C4', $ADR));
     $MSK = join(".", unpack('C4', $MSK));
-    
+
     1;
 }